当前位置:
文档之家› 项目六 人机界面(HMI)的组态与应用
项目六 人机界面(HMI)的组态与应用
”按钮或者鼠标直接
图6.43 编写程序界面
任务实施操作步骤
五、下载项目
先下载 PLC 项目程序。在项目视图中,选中项目树中的“PLC1(CPU1214C)” 单击工具栏中的下载图标“ ”,打开“扩展的下载到设备”对话框,如图 6.44 所示。此处勾选“显示所有可访问设备”,若已将编程计算机和 PLC 连接好,则 将显示当前网络中所有可访问的设备,选中目标 PLC,单击“下载”按钮,将项 目下载到 S7-1200PLC 中。
6.1.1 人机界面与触摸屏
2.触摸屏 西门子的触摸屏面板(Touch Panel,TP),一般俗称为触摸屏。
触摸屏是人机界面的发展方向,用户可以在触摸屏的屏幕 上生成满足自己要求的触摸式按键。触摸屏使用直观方便, 易于操作。画面上的按钮和指示灯可以取代相应的硬件元 件,减少PLC需要的I/O点数,降低系统的成本,提高设备的 性能和附加价值。
图6.2 创建新项目1
图6.3 创建新项目2
一、系统硬件组态
2、添加硬件设备
①添加PLC控制器。 如图6.3,单击“设备与网络”选项中的“组
态设备”,添加系统相关硬件设备,出现图 6.4所示窗口。单击图6.4窗口中的“添加新设 备”,出现如图6.5“新设备”选择窗口。
图6.4 组态硬件设备及网络窗口
项目六 人机界面(HMI)的组态与应用 任务18 基于触摸屏实现电机启停控制
任务介绍
本项目任务选择西门子SIMATIC HMI精简系列面板KTP700 BASIC PN触摸屏作为人机界面,以S7-1200作为控制器,通 过单击触摸屏上的“启动”和“停止”按钮,实现对电机 的启停控制,并且通过触摸屏上的“系统指示灯”和“电 机状态显示”等对象实现对现场系统工作状态的监控功能。
最后,两个按钮组态完的画面如图6.40所示。 图6.40 按钮组态(13)
(5)画面切换组态 在系统运行过程中,经常需 要在不同的画面中进行切换。 可以按如下操作来完成不同 画面的切换功能。 打开初始画面,用左键按住 项目树的“控制画面”,拖 到“初始画面”中,自动生 成一个“初始画面”与“控 制画面”之间的画面切换按 钮,如图6.41所示。
本任务从基于触摸屏控制电机启停项目的项目创建、 硬件组态、网络组态、画面组态、对象属性设置、变 量连接及动画组态以及系统下载、仿真调试等操作过 程具体介绍了有关HMI人机界面控制系统的组态及应用 技术的操作实施步骤。
项目六 人机界面(HMI)的组态与应用
6.1 人机界面的认识
6界面(Human Machine Interface)又称 人机接口,简称HMI。从广义上说,HMI泛指 计算机与操作人员交换信息的设备;在控制 领域,HMI一般特指用于操作人员与控制系 统间进行对话和相互作用的专用设备。
6.1.1 人机界面与触摸屏
功能 :
人机界面主要承担以下任务: (1)过程可视化。在人机界面上动态显示过程数据(即PLC采集的现场数 据)。 (2)操作员对过程的控制。操作员通过图形界面来控制过程。 (3)显示报警。当变量超出或低于设定值时,会自动触发报警。 (4)记录功能。顺序记录过程值和报警信息,用户可以检索以前的生产数 据。 (5)输出过程值和记录报警。如可以在某一轮班结束时打印输出生产报表。 (6)过程和设备的参数管理。将过程和设备的参数存储在配方中,可以一 次性将这些参数从人机界面下载到控制系统中,以便改变产品的品种。
能初步设置人机面板与PLC通信参数,并实现相互通信。
能初步对精简系列面板构成的监控系统进行运行和调试。 具备资料收集、整理和自我学习的能力。 具备顺利地与相关人员进行沟通、协调和交流的能力。
项目六 人机界面(HMI)的组态与应用
引言 :人机界面装置是操作人员与PLC之间双向沟通 的桥梁,许多工业被控对象要求控制系统具有很强的 人机界面功能。S7-1200与SIMATIC HMI精简系列面板 无缝兼容,极大地增强了控制系统的人机交互操作功 能 。 本 项 目 选 择 西 门 子 SIMATIC HMI 精 简 系 列 面 板 KTP700 BASIC PN触摸屏作为人机界面,以西门子S71200 PLC作为控制器,通过“基于触摸屏实现电机启 停控制”任务来学习西门子人机界面的组态和应用技 术。
在图6.5中,单击 “控制器”下面的
▶→SIMATIC S71200,出现图6.6目 标CPU选择窗口。
图6.5 新设备选择窗口
单击CPU1214CDC/DC/DC, 单击供货号6ES72141AG40-0XB0,单击右下 角添加,出现如图 6.7“添加新设备”所 示窗口,此时一个PLC 控制器设备添加完毕。
点击项目工具栏中的开始仿真运行“ ”图标,弹出“启动模拟”窗口(见
图 6.46),点击窗口中的“确定”按钮,开始触摸屏项目的仿真运行。仿真运行 结果如图 6.47,图 6.48 所示。
图6.46 启动仿真模拟运行
图6.47 仿真模拟运行-进入初始画面
图6.48 仿真模拟运行-进入控制画面
任务小结
图6.6 选择目标CPU
图6.7 添加PLC控制器新设备界面
一、系统硬件组态
②添加HMI设备 如图6.8所示,重新选择 “添加设备”,单击 “SIMATIC HMI”按钮, 在中间的目录树中HMI 设备,选择 HMI→SIMATIC精简系列 面板→7"显示屏 →KTP700 BASIC,选择 对应订货号的面板。
图6.44 扩展的下载到设备对话框
然后下载 HMI 程序。在项目视图中,选择项目树中的“HMI(KTP700 Basic PN)”项,单击工具栏内的下载按钮“ ”图标,如图 6.45 所示,将 HMI 项目 下载到面板中。
图6.45 HMI组态画面下载
任务实施操作步骤
六、运行调试项目
(1)HMI 仿真模拟运行
辑界面,拖动编辑区工具栏上的一个常开触点“ ”、一个常闭触点“ ”,
和一个输出线圈“ 到程序段 1,输入地址 M0.0、M0.1 和 Q0.0,则在地址下 出现系统自动分配的符号名称,可以进行修改,此处不修改。拖动常开触点到
M0.0 所在触点的下方,点击编辑区工具栏关闭分支“ 向上拖动得到完整的梯形图,输入地址 Q0.0。
图6.15 工具箱文本域选择
图6.16 文本域属性设置(1)
图6.17 文本域属性设置(2)
在初始画面中再添加 三个文本域,分别显 示“设计单位:北京 经济管理职业学院”, “设计人员:张三” 和“设计时间:2017 年9月10日”。结果如 图6.18所示
图6.18 初始画面组态效果
(4)控制画面组态 根据任务要求,在控制画面中,需要有两个 按钮(启动和停止)、一个电机、电机运行 状态指示灯来实现电机的启停控制和状态监 控。下面逐步介绍控制画面的组态过程。
图6.20 电机组态(2)
②按钮组态 单击工具箱中的“元素”→“按钮” 图标拖放到画面上,按钮图标跟 随光标一起移动,按钮左上角在画面上的 X、Y 轴的坐标(X/Y)和按钮的宽、 高尺寸(均以像素为单位)也跟随光标一起移动。放开鼠标左键,按钮被放置在 画面上。此时按钮的四周有 8 个小正方形,可以用前面介绍的鼠标的使用方法来 调整按钮的位置的大小。在画面上添加两个按钮(见图 6.28)。
项目六 人机界面(HMI)的组态与应用
项目六 人机界面(HMI)的组态与应用
教学导航
知识重点:
了解人机界面在控制系统中的功能及应用。 了解精简系列面板的特点、结构及作用。 熟悉精简系列面板的组态应用操作实施步骤。
知识难点:
触摸屏变量连接和对象属性设置。
能力目标:
能初步对精简系列面板构成的监控系统项目进行正确创建和 组态。
图6.31 按钮组态(4) 图6.32 按钮组态(5)
图 6.33 按钮组态(6) 图 6.34 按钮组态(7) 图 6.35 按钮组态(8)
打开“事件”→“释放”对话框,操作和上面“按下”类似,调用系统函数 的复位函数“编辑位”→“复位位”,对“启动”变量复位,如图 6.36 所示。
图 6.36 按钮组态(9)
①电机组态 和初始画面组态过程一样,双击“控制画面” 打开控制画面。在控制画面中,单击左边工 具箱窗口的“图形”(见图6.19),在 “WinCC图形文件夹/Automation equipment/Motors/256colors”中选择一个 电机模型拖放入控制画面工作区,如图6.20 所示。
图6.19 电机组态(1)
图6.9 网络配置视图
二、设备网络组态
图6.10 网络连接视图
任务实施操作步骤
三、HMI可视化组态
1、画面布局 根据任务要求,系统画面分为“初始画面”和“控制 画面”,“初始画面”作为启动系统时进入的信息显 示相关画面,“控制画面”为系统主要监控画面,实 现系统的控制和状态监控功能。
2、创建画面 在项目视图的项目树中左侧HMI设备中 选择双击“画面”选项,出现“添加新 画面”和“画面1”两项(如图6.11)。 点击“添加新画面”,得到“画面1” 和“画面2”两个画面。现把“画面1” 作为初始画面,“画面2”作为“控制 画面”。
任务实施操作步骤
二、设备网络组态
添加完HMI设备后,选择 “组态网络”项,则进入 到项目视图的“网络视图” 画面,如图6.9所示,单击 “网络视图”中呈现绿色 的CPU1214C的PROFINET网 络接口,按住鼠标左键拖 动至呈现绿色的KTP屏的 PROFINET网络接口上,则 二者的PROFINET网络就连 上了(如图6.10所示), 可以在“网络属性对话框” 中修改网络名称。
任务18 基于触摸屏实现电机启停控制
任务实施操作步骤 一、系统硬件组态 1、创建项目
①首先启动TIA Portal V13软件。从桌面上直接双击 ,启动 该软件,打开图6.1所示窗口。
图6.1 TIA Portal V13启动窗口